Animal lawyer Rebeka Breder says pet custody terms should be put in writing. Harlen is a vizsla, an active breed known for their fierce loyalty. (Ian Birnie) A man in Pemberton, B.C., has gotten his dog back after a months-long battle with his ex-girlfriend that started with shared custody and escalated to her making a unilateral decision to keep the pet to herself in Vancouver.
